Output d1ed19a80990466117793afbd95327e0b029315b18eecda99381d79789520d0e:37

value
704963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f24a85b56e6f3f1e16fa926353654fc3daca63e0 OP_EQUAL
address
3Pn8isEQfCbCnbpp89eiwTCQWfZWdT11Hx
transaction
d1ed19a80990466117793afbd95327e0b029315b18eecda99381d79789520d0e
spent
true